install命令示例
以下命令提供了如何使用 install Linux 命令复制文件的示例。
每个文件夹和文件都应根据情况进行自定义。
$install -D /source/folder/*.py /destination/folder
这里,-D 选项用于将 .py 文件从 /source/folder 复制到 /destination/folder 文件夹。
同样,除了 install 和 -D 之外的所有内容都应该更改以适合文件和文件夹。
如果我们需要制作目标文件夹,请使用此命令,例如:
$install -d /destination/folder
使用“install”命令在 Linux 中复制文件
Linux 系统上的 install 命令通过将多个命令合二为一来复制文件。
install 命令使用 cp、chown、chmod 和 strip 命令。
但是,不应使用 install 命令来安装准备使用的应用程序。
这些应该使用 Linux 发行版的包管理系统下载和安装。
install命令语法
install 命令的正确语法包括选项、源文件和目标文件。
install [OPTION]... SOURCE DEST install [OPTION]... SOURCE... DIRECTORY install [OPTION]... -t DIRECTORY SOURCE install [OPTION]... -d DIRECTORY
这些是控制安装命令的选项:
- --backup [=CONTROL] 备份每个现有的目标文件。
- -b 类似于 --backup 但不接受参数。
- -c 是(忽略)。
- -d , --directory 将所有参数视为目录名称;创建指定目录的所有组件。
- -D 创建除最后一个之外的 DEST 的所有主要组件,然后将 SOURCE 复制到 DEST。它在上面的第一种格式中很有用。
- -g , --group =GROUP 设置组所有权。
- -m , --mode =MODE 设置权限模式(如在 chmod 中),而不是 rwxr-xr-x。
- -o , --owner =OWNER 设置所有权(仅限超级用户)。
- -p , --preserve-timestamps 将源文件的访问/修改时间应用于相应的目标文件。
- -s , --strip 去除符号表。它仅对上述第一种和第二种格式有用。
- -S , --suffix =SUFFIX 覆盖通常的备份后缀。
- -v , --verbose 在创建时打印每个目录的名称。
- -z, --context-CONTEXT 设置文件和目录的 SELinux 安全上下文。
- --help 显示帮助信息并退出。
- --version 输出版本信息并退出。
备份后缀是 ~ 除非使用 --suffix 或者 SIMPLE_BACKUP_SUFFIX 环境变量设置。
可以使用 --backup 选项或者通过 VERSION_CONTROL 环境变量选择版本控制方法。
这些是值:
- none, off 从不进行备份(即使给出了 --backup )。
- numbered, t 进行编号备份。
- 存在,如果存在编号的备份,则 nil 编号:否则;这很简单。
- 简单,永远不要做简单的备份。
install 命令的完整文档作为 Texinfo 手册维护。
如果 info 和 install 程序已正确安装在站点上,则命令 info install 应访问完整的手册。
日期:2020-07-15 11:16:30 来源:oir作者:oir